Important Update: Student Accounts Disabled Nightly

Beginning May 12th, student accounts will be unavailable from 11:00 pm to 5:00 am daily. This is a new initiative we're implementing to encourage students to unplug and rest.


We believe it is essential for students to take breaks from technology and prioritize their physical and mental well-being. By disabling their accounts during these hours, we hope to encourage them to disconnect and focus on other activities that promote relaxation and rejuvenation.


Please note that during this time, students will not be able to access their accounts and other resources from District-issued devices.


We appreciate your support in this initiative, and we believe it will have a positive impact on our students' overall health and well-being.

Wireless Certificate Update
After system updates are applied on the evening of Monday, May 8th, some devices (Mac, iPad’s, Personal BYOD)
will require you to accept a new certificate before they are able to reconnect back to the District network. If you have any problems or issues, please feel free to contact the helpdesk.

Blue Line Art Gallery Field Trip Information

Bring your class to Blue Line Arts for a multifaceted and engaging arts experience! Tour Talk & Create includes a tour of Blue Line’s high caliber exhibitions using Visual Thinking Strategies to promote discussion. After the tour, students will participate in a hands-on art making activity curated by a professional artist.  This program is free for Title 1 Designated Schools (including reimbursement for bus travel to and from Blue Line Arts).  Please see the website for costs for non Title 1 schools.
